在云计算环境中,OpenStack作为一种广泛使用的开源平台,为用户提供灵活、高效的计算资源管理。在实际操作中,可能会遇到云主机意外断电的情况。本文将探讨OpenStack云主机断电对网络连接的具体影响,并提出相应的解决方案。
一、断电对网络连接的影响
1. 网络服务中断
当云主机发生断电时,其上运行的网络服务(如Web服务器、数据库服务器等)会立即停止工作,导致外部用户无法访问这些服务。对于依赖这些服务的应用程序和业务流程来说,这可能引发一系列问题,例如交易失败、数据丢失等。
2. 虚拟网络组件失效
OpenStack中的虚拟网络组件(如Neutron)负责管理和配置云环境中的网络资源。一旦云主机断电,与之关联的虚拟交换机、路由器等功能也会受到影响,可能导致整个虚拟网络出现故障,影响到其他正常运行的云主机之间的通信。
3. 数据传输中断
正在进行的数据传输任务会在断电瞬间被强制终止,未完成的数据包可能会丢失,需要重新建立连接并重新发送数据,增加了网络延迟和带宽消耗。
二、解决方案
1. 提供可靠的电源保障
为了防止因电力供应不稳定而导致的云主机断电问题,可以考虑采用不间断电源(UPS)系统或备用发电机来确保数据中心内的电力供应持续稳定。定期检查维护电气设备,避免由于设备老化等原因造成的突发性断电事故。
2. 实施高可用架构
通过部署多个冗余节点和服务实例,即使某个节点发生故障,其他节点也可以接管其工作负载,从而保证服务的连续性和可靠性。还可以利用负载均衡器分散流量压力,提高系统的容错能力。
3. 配置自动恢复机制
设置适当的监控告警规则,一旦检测到云主机断电事件,及时通知管理员采取措施;并且在条件允许的情况下,启用自动化脚本或工具实现快速重启、迁移等操作,缩短服务中断时间。
4. 优化网络设计
合理规划虚拟网络拓扑结构,减少单点故障的可能性;增加链路冗余度,以应对可能出现的物理线路损坏等问题;同时加强对网络安全性的防护,防止恶意攻击造成不必要的损失。
虽然OpenStack云主机断电会对网络连接产生一定的负面影响,但只要我们提前做好预防措施并积极应对突发状况,就能够有效地降低风险,保障业务的平稳运行。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/92660.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。